A Historic Milestone for Pakistan’s Medical Frontier
Armed Forces Bone Marrow Transplant Centre (AFBMTC), Rawalpindi, is proud to announce the successful completion of the first CAR T-cell therapy in Pakistan.
Alhamdulilah The recipient, a 21-year-old patient with relapsed/refractory B-cell acute lymphoblastic leukaemia (R/R B-ALL) who had relapsed twice on previous lines of treatment received indigenously prepared anti-CD19 CAR T-cell therapy on 18 June 2026 and achieved a measurable residual disease (MRD)-negative complete remission by Day +14. He was discharged on 3 July 2026.
This milestone marks the dawn of a new era for cellular and immune-effector therapies in Pakistan. It brings an advanced, potentially curative treatment option, previously unavailable nationwide and limited globally, to patients who otherwise had exhausted all conventional treatment avenues.
This monumental achievement is the fruit of years of dedicated preparation by the entire AFBMTC team, including our physicians, apheresis and cell-processing scientists, laboratory professionals, and nursing staff, all working under the umbrella of the Army Medical Corps.

“COMPLETE CASE PRESENTATION”
Patient Identification
Muhammad Sharif, son of Muhammad Faiz Bakhsh, 80 years old, married male, resident of Multan.
---
Presenting Complaints
He presented to the Emergency Room on 30th May 2026 (3 days ago) with complaints of :
1. Fever for 10 days
2. Cough for 7 days
History of Presenting Illness
The patient was apparently well 10 days ago when he developed fever. The fever was sudden in onset, high grade, associated with rigors and chills, and fluctuating between 100°F to 102°F. The pattern of fever was continuous. It was associated with headache and sore throat. There was no history of ear discharge, pain in the right hypochondrium, flank pain, difficulty in urination, blood in urine, or night sweats.
Seven days ago, the patient developed cough. The cough was gradual in onset, frequent in occurrence, and productive in nature, present during both day and night. It was associated with moderate amount of greenish, foul-smelling sputum. There was no history of blood in sputum. The cough was aggravated by drinking water and relieved on taking cough syrup.
Symptomatically, both fever and cough showed partial relief with Panadol CF.
It was not associated with shortness of breath, breathlessness on exertion, shortness of breath on lying flat, night time awakening due to breathlessness, wheezing, chest pain (including pleuritic chest pain), hoarseness of voice, or runny nose. Despite cough being aggravated by drinking water, there was no history of choking episodes, persistent difficulty or pain during swallowing, or focal neurological deficits.
There was no history of recent flu-like illness, body aches, loss of smell or taste, or recent sick contacts.
